power: supply: max17042_battery: fix model download bug.

The device's model download function returns the model data as
an array of u32s, which is later compared to the reference
model data. However, since the latter is an array of u16s,
the comparison does not happen correctly, and model verification
fails. This in turn breaks the POR initialization sequence.

Fixes: 39e7213edc ("max17042_battery: Support regmap to access device's registers")
